Output 188eaa3e552259929dc5c6ad71c28314c94de5f68e5d0d34b0a6efaffcf6367c:0

value
40804
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40f93eb91b3a84f06f94633f6bb7c6083c782e04 OP_EQUAL
address
37cZkfhC71ADJB2qEeQ3opaf2VzaEYqGUn
transaction
188eaa3e552259929dc5c6ad71c28314c94de5f68e5d0d34b0a6efaffcf6367c
confirmations
396874
spent
true